TOPIC 11:  TAKING QUIZZES AND TESTS

 

Quizzes:  Some classes require that the student take regular quizzes over course material.  Check the course syllabus for information regarding quiz requirements.  To take a quiz, click on the Quiz Icon on the course WebCT Homepage and then click on the name of the quiz you want to take.  You will see a list of questions in the form of multiple choice, matching, and/or short answer.  Read each question carefully and then click or type your response to each question.  After answering each question you must click on “Save Answer” for your answers to be graded.  If the quiz marks one of your answers wrong and you think it is correct, please contact your instructor.  The question will be checked to see if an error has been made.  Please indicate the quiz, the question number, and provide a page number in the textbook that supports your answer.  In some courses you will be allowed to take each quiz two times if you choose.  Again, check the course syllabus for specifics about quiz taking in your course.

 

Tests:  This course requires that the students take tests during the semester.  Tests are completed in the same fashion as quizzes.  However, tests may only become available at certain times on certain days.  Check the Assessment page for test dates.

 

This course uses the word Assessment for both Quizzes and Tests.
